Sega considering Netflix-like game subscription service     (www.bbc.com)
submitted by dosvydanya_freedomz to gaming 4 months ago (+4/-0)
8 comments last comment...
https://www.bbc.com/news/articles/ckgnj7e8028o

Sega is considering launching its own Netflix-like subscription service for video games, a move which would accelerate gaming's transition towards streaming.

There are already a number of similar services on the market - such as Xbox Game Pass and PlayStation Plus - which see gamers pay a monthly fee for access to a range of titles rather than owning them outright.

Sega's president Shuji Utsumi told the BBC such subscription products were "very interesting", and his firm was "evaluating some opportunities".
